Australian market Ford Ranger Wildtrak V6 diesel variant pictured. A similar version is rumoured to enter Malaysia soon.


Citing an unnamed yet highly credible insider source, our friends over at local Bahasa language portal Careta.my have caught wind that Sime Darby Auto Connexion (SDAC) Ford could introduce the V6 diesel version of the current-generation Ford Ranger Wildtrak in Malaysia soon.

No exact launch timeline was specified by the unnamed source noted, but the rumoured new Wildtrak model variant is most certainly set to cost higher than the 4-cyl version currently on sale through importers and distributors SDAC Ford – more on this in a bit.

Presently, the Ford Ranger Wildtrak is marketed in Malaysia solely with a 2.0-litre 4-cyl bi-turbo diesel lump that it shares with the XLT Plus, XLT Plus Special Edition, StormTrak, Platinum, and Raptor 2.0 Bi-Turbo variants.


Presently, the Wildtrak guise of the popular premium 4x4 pick-up truck is marketed in Malaysia solely with a 2.0-litre bi-turbo diesel heart outputting 210 PS and 500 NM. Said mill is paired with a 10-speed automatic box plus a part-time 4x4 driveline with an electronic rear diff-lock.

It’s also worth noting that this powertrain setup is shared by the Wildtrak with scores of other Ranger variants that include the XLT Plus, XLT Plus Special Edition, StormTrak, Platinum, as well as the Ranger Raptor 2.0 Bi-Turbo guise.

In both neighbouring Thailand and Australia, the Wildtrak variant sees a V6 diesel powertrain offered as an option alongside the 4-cyl mill detailed.


In contrast, the Ranger Wildtrak marketed in both neighbouring Thailand and Australia sees the same 4-cyl mill offered as an option alongside a 3.0-litre V6 turbo-diesel choice. The latter boasts peppier headlining figures of 250 PS and 600 NM instead, plus a full-time 4x4 driveline.

naturally the extra cylinders – and heightened outputs – are set to come at a slight premium versus the current 4-cyl version’s RM170,888 price tag. For reference, the StormTrakPlatinum, and  Ranger Raptor 2.0 Bi-Turbo guises costs more at RM181,888, RM191,888, and RM248,888 respectively.

The extra cylinders does translate into higher outputs of 250 PS and 600 NM. For reference, the 4-cyl lump offers just 210 PS and 500 NM.


We speculate that SDAC Ford could introduce and price this V6-engined Wildtrak variant anywhere between RM200,000 and RM220,000. In terms of price positioning, this would mirror how the same model variant is marketed in Australia too.

Aptly, with the decline of diesel vehicle sales prompted by the rationalised diesel fuel price subsidy scheme, it’s difficult to speculate just how well received this new V6-engined version of the Ranger Wildtrak will be received in the local market.
